Output e6323ecbc03bf69d04c077a895b56e6585d5e56daaeaf7ebb46659db08fd4834:0

value
66530030
script pubkey
OP_0 OP_PUSHBYTES_20 6c15fba58a7c36bbc6b44fb7366bd0725d8c8c6b
address
ltc1qds2lhfv20smth345f7mnv67swfwcerrta6duak
transaction
e6323ecbc03bf69d04c077a895b56e6585d5e56daaeaf7ebb46659db08fd4834
spent
true